Frequently Asked Questions about Prayer Times in Ar Rifa

Fajr prayer time in Ar Rifa, Saudi Arabia is at dawn (Asia/Bahrain timezone). It begins at true dawn (when the first light appears) and ends just before sunrise. For accurate daily Fajr times, please check our prayer times table above.

Dhuhr (Zuhr) prayer in Ar Rifa begins at noon (Asia/Bahrain timezone), after the sun passes its zenith. It is the second prayer of the day and marks the midday break. The time varies slightly throughout the year based on the sun's position.

Asr prayer time in Ar Rifa is at afternoon (Asia/Bahrain timezone). It begins when the shadow of an object equals its length (or twice its length according to Hanafi school). This is the third prayer of the day.

Maghrib prayer in Ar Rifa starts at sunset (Asia/Bahrain timezone), immediately after sunset. It is the fourth daily prayer and a special time, especially during Ramadan when it marks the time to break fast.

Isha prayer time in Ar Rifa is at night (Asia/Bahrain timezone). It begins after the red twilight disappears from the sky and is the fifth and final obligatory prayer of the day.

Prayer times for Ar Rifa are calculated using the Umm Al-Qura University, Makkah calculation method, which is one of the most reliable Islamic methods. The calculations are based on the geographic coordinates of Ar Rifa and adjusted for the Asia/Bahrain timezone to ensure accuracy for local residents.

Prayer times change daily in Ar Rifa because they are based on the sun's position. As the earth rotates and orbits the sun, sunrise, sunset, and the angles for Fajr and Isha shift slightly each day. All times are shown in Asia/Bahrain timezone for your convenience.
